.auth-module__4BZmqq__page{background:radial-gradient(circle at 50% 0,#8b5cf61a 0%,#0000 50%);justify-content:center;align-items:center;min-height:100vh;padding:4rem 2rem;display:flex}.auth-module__4BZmqq__authBox{border-radius:30px;width:100%;max-width:500px;padding:4rem}.auth-module__4BZmqq__header{text-align:center;margin-bottom:3rem}.auth-module__4BZmqq__header h1{margin-bottom:.5rem;font-size:2.5rem}.auth-module__4BZmqq__header p{color:#ffffff80;font-size:.95rem}.auth-module__4BZmqq__form{flex-direction:column;gap:2rem;display:flex}.auth-module__4BZmqq__formGroup{flex-direction:column;gap:.75rem;display:flex}.auth-module__4BZmqq__formGroup label{color:#ffffffb3;align-items:center;gap:.5rem;font-size:.85rem;font-weight:600;display:flex}.auth-module__4BZmqq__formGroup input{color:#fff;background:#ffffff0d;border:1px solid #ffffff1a;border-radius:12px;padding:1rem;font-family:inherit;transition:all .2s}.auth-module__4BZmqq__formGroup input:focus{border-color:var(--primary);background:#ffffff14;outline:none}.auth-module__4BZmqq__options{justify-content:space-between;align-items:center;font-size:.85rem;display:flex}.auth-module__4BZmqq__remember{color:#fff9;cursor:pointer;align-items:center;gap:.5rem;display:flex}.auth-module__4BZmqq__forgot{color:var(--primary);font-weight:600}.auth-module__4BZmqq__terms{color:#ffffff80;text-align:center;font-size:.8rem;line-height:1.5}.auth-module__4BZmqq__terms a{color:var(--secondary);text-decoration:underline}.auth-module__4BZmqq__footer{text-align:center;color:#ffffff80;margin-top:3rem;font-size:.9rem}.auth-module__4BZmqq__footer a{color:var(--primary);font-weight:600}@media (max-width:576px){.auth-module__4BZmqq__authBox{padding:3rem 2rem}}.auth-module__4BZmqq__errorMessage{color:#ef4444;text-align:center;background:#ef44441a;border:1px solid #ef444433;border-radius:12px;margin-bottom:2rem;padding:1rem;font-size:.9rem}
